Bug Description

If you come across a blueprint (such as https://blueprints.launchpad.net/ubuntu/+spec/niversal-updater) that does not have a URL for a wiki page set, you cannot comment on the blueprint. You'll see a link "Set the URL for this specification," however as pointed out in bug #105759 the link may be active but almost no regular users are allowed to set this field on the blueprint.

As a fallback I wrote some comments in the "Status Whiteboard," but I don't believe that's the right place to leave comments and anyone can come along and delete the text in that field.

I suggest that either the URL be a mandatory field in the New Blueprint form, or that launchpad create a new wiki page if none is specified.
